What is Android Things?
Android Things is an extension of the Android platform for IoT and embedded devices.
CamerasGatewaysHVAC ControlSmart Meters
Point of SaleInventory ControlInteractive AdsVending Machines
Security SystemsSmart DoorbellsRoutersEnergy Monitors
Asset TrackingFleet ManagementDriver AssistPredictive Service
Ideal for powerful, intelligent devices that need to be secure.

Cons
● Only Dev Preview
● Weave not yet available for Android Things
● Very new - Not many examples online - mostly Python
● Some APIs not supported - ie hardwareAcceleration
● Closed Source
Electronics Basics
Components
Breadboard - Construction base for prototyping electronics
Jumper Wire - Used to interconnect the components of a breadboard
LEDs - Emits visible light when an electric current passes through it
Push Switches - Allows electricity to flow between its two contacts
Components
Resistor -Used to reduce current flow

Ohm’s Law
The current through a conductor between two points is directly proportional to the voltage across the two points.
V = I * R V is Voltage (volts)I is Current (amps) R is Resistance (ohms)
I = 0.023AV = 5V
R = 5V / 0.023A R = ± 217 ohms

//get access to the pin
PeripheralManagerService service = new PeripheralManagerService();
ledGpio = service.openGpio("BCM6");
ledGpio.setDirection(Gpio.DIRECTION_OUT_INITIALLY_LOW);
ledGpio.setValue(true);
//remember to close the peripheral
ledGpio.close();
Turn on an LED
